Section 23-2-427 - Orders, rules, etc., of department not controverted in actions between private person and railroad company

In all actions between private parties and railroad companies brought under Acts 1899, No. 53, the rates, charges, orders, rules, regulations, and classifications prescribed by the Arkansas Department of Transportation before the institution of the action shall be held, deemed, and accepted to be reasonable, fair, and just, and in such respects shall not be controverted therein.
